🎮 Level Up Your Retro Game Night with HD Brilliance!
The POUND HD Link Cable transforms your Sega Genesis gaming experience by upscaling original 240p output to crisp 720p HD, preserving the classic 4:3 aspect ratio. Compatible with Genesis models 1, 2, and 3 via an included converter, it uses native RGB signals for superior color and sharpness. The bundled Micro USB cable boosts power to reduce strain on your vintage console’s internal supply, making it the perfect plug-and-play upgrade for retro enthusiasts craving modern display quality.

Good bang for the buck that will satisfy most people
I had my original genesis model 1 hooked up via RF, and it looked tragically bad. Composite helped improve the picture quality, but my new 4K TV doesn’t support any analog inputs. Instead of trying to go the expensive route via component cables and a scaler, which would run a minimum of $150, or the never in stock RAD2X for the genesis, I thought I’d give the $30 pound adapter a try. Pros: -Cheap and available -Huge improvement over RF/composite video output. It taps into the RGB signal and delivers very clean video out out with the exception of jailbars (model 1 genesis only, not Pound’s fault) -separation between converter dongle and HDMI cable allows for use with other HDMI cables -Hooks into modern TVs with no fuss! Cons: -contrast is higher than it needs to be, and the colors seem to be a little washed out as a result as well as some loss in detail. I think the need to recheck how they are driving each channel of RGB and tune this a little better. -requires external power -no stereo sound dongle for model 1 systems -construction could be a little nicer (metal housing for the adapter instead of plastic, with some thermal pads because I noticed it does get quite warm) Overall I’d give it a 4/5 purely on price-performance ratio. Its not the best solution for the genesis, but it certainly is the most convenient. I wish Pound could get together with the author/creator of retrotink and build the best possible solution together, and mass produce it. I’ll probably give their other adapters a try at some point. Looks fantastic, no lag at all
The Sega Genesis, like all Sega consoles, has a RGB output that us Americans really can't take advantage of without some high end equipment - but this cable converts that to a modern HDMI signal and the results are fantastic with no lag that I can notice. I tried out Ghouls 'n Ghosts, a game I've played hundreds of times on a CRT, and results are fantastic - everything felt exactly how I expected, yet it looked like I was playing a emulator as the graphics were so crisp. I used this with a Sega Nomad, which is based on the model 2 Genesis, and on battery I had no issues with signal drops or anything. In the box you also get a model 1 converter. I'm really impressed by this - I've never used or even seen the RGB out on the Genesis, and it's great. Make sure you have gaming mode on your TV, or better use a gaming low latency monitor for best results. Also with these cables on other devices I've seen people complain about dark images - well no issue here, with my default settings left in place on my monitor the image looked great. Another thing I've seen with other cables is people saying the image contrast was too high and you'd lose image detail - and again, no issue here. Again, the best way to compare the video for those that haven't used RGB output on this system is that i looks like a good emulator in the best way possible, meaning zero lag, perfect picture quality, no noticeable video noise.

Finicky cable, works some of the time and seems overpriced for the issues that come with it.
This cable preserves a 4:3 ratio unlike some others out there that stretch the image to 16:9. There might be a way around this, but it seems like the pound sends out a 16:9 signal and just adds black bars to the side. Not really an issue if you just want to play a Genesis on your HDTV, but might be an issue if you are capturing the game play on a computer for streaming. At least on my Gen 1 Genesis, the cable is really hard to connect and doesn't seem to want to sit correctly and I have to shove it in hard (almost as if the pins are just a little bit off on size). I've come back to see that the cable fell out despite how hard I had to shove it in to begin with, and I've also had to replug it in when the video was missing a color or otherwise messed up. On at least one occasion the pound seemed to not even be sending a signal and I had to unplug everything and reconnect it to work (this might have simply been my capture card, though). The pound box is powered by a USB cable. It does not come with a wall plug for this cable, but my power strip has USB connections, so not a big deal. This box also is warm and always on. Not sure if there are any dangers to sending a hot signal to an HDMI port 24/7. When a the Genesis is not on, you just get a "no signal" box on the screen, and as far as I know the pound does not go into sleep mode if not used for a while (maybe it does, and that would explain the time I had to unplug and reconnect it to get a signal). Overall, the cable does what it needs to do, sends an upscaled 4:3 aspect ratio over HDMI. The cable just feels more like one of those no name Chinese adapters, but with a premium price tag.
